Agriculture News June 27, 2024

27 thg 6, 2024

Wet Weather Forecasts Across Most of the Corn Belt Are Not Favorable for Buyers. Last night, the EIA report showed that more than 1 million barrels of ethanol were produced per day in the week ending June 21, a decrease of 14,000 barrels per day from the previous week. Ethanol inventories recorded over 23.4 million barrels, down 194,000 barrels.


Tonight, the export sales report will be released, with the estimated range for old crop corn from 0.4 to 1.1 million tons for the week ending June 20. The new crop is estimated at 0 to 200,000 tons.


The market is looking forward to the acreage and quarterly corn inventory report from the USDA this Friday.


September Corn Futures prices continued to decline, with the settlement price on June 26 at 425.5 cents per bushel, down 1.45% from the previous session.


For the Soybean Market. The estimated range for weekly export sales for the week ending June 20 is from 300,000 to 600,000 tons for the 2023/24 marketing year. The new crop is projected at 0 to 200,000 tons.


Similar to corn, the soybean market is also awaiting the USDA's acreage and quarterly soybean inventory report on Friday evening.


September Soybean Futures prices fell, with the settlement price on June 26 at 1,107.25 cents per bushel, down 0.4% from the previous session.


Looking Ahead to the Export Sales Report. The estimated sales for wheat for the week ending June 20 are from 200,000 to 600,000 tons.


The market is waiting for the USDA's acreage and quarterly wheat inventory report to be released this Friday.


The Ukrainian Ministry of Agriculture estimates wheat exports for the 2023/24 marketing year (from July to June next year) at 18.3 million tons. Meanwhile, Algeria has purchased at least 130,000 to 150,000 tons of wheat in a tender on Wednesday.


September Wheat Futures prices were flat. The settlement price on June 26 was 560.5 cents per bushel, unchanged from the previous session.
